Chap 8. Power Supplies Flashcards

(PSU) in a computer converts high-voltage AC power from the wall socket to low-voltage DC power to the PC components. PSU Components The PSU contains transformers (to step down to lower voltages), rectifiers (to convert AC to DC), and filters and regulators (to ensure a "clean" output or steady voltage). Power Transformers: Definition, Types, and

A power transformer is a static device that transfers electrical energy from one circuit to another without changing the frequency. It works on the principle of electromagnetic induction and can step up or step down the

Class II power supplies explained

Class II power supplies. A Class II component, or open frame power supply, needs no earth connection for safe operation. The minimum distance from any live part to the enclosure must be observed whether it is conductive or not in order to maintain the two levels of protection needed against a single failure in the system.

Campsite Electricity

This electrical supply can be used either directly to power 230V equipment or indirectly via a power supply unit that converts the mains power at 230V AC to a nominal 12V DC, usually in conjunction with a leisure battery. Pollution Degree Ratings for Power Supplies | Blogs | TDK

Pollution Degree 3 you would find in harsh industrial and farming, particularly with unheated rooms. Conductive pollution is to be expected, with or without condensation. Pollution Degree 4 is outdoor equipment. Persistent conductivity, rain or even snow is the norm. Could a pollution degree 2 power supply be used in an outdoor application?

Installing an electrical supply to an outbuilding

Supply from the dwelling. The conventional method for a new supply to a garage would be to utilise an existing spare way in the consumer unit. A typical garage would generally require a maximum supply of 20 A while making allowance for diversity (Regulation 311.1).

What is a 'pollution degree' for a power supply?

By “pollution”, we mean contaminants such as condensation, water and a variety of dusts. The three main safety standards for power supplies (IEC 60950-1, IEC 60601-1 and IEC 61010-1) all call up pollution degree classifications, and in general the wording is similar. Pollution Degree 1 is the least stringent.

What is a DC/DC power supply?

Some power supply circuits are known as DC/DC power supplies. These power supplies convert an unstable DC into a stabilized DC, providing a constant output voltage that cannot be varied.

How much power does an outbuilding need?

What you plan to do in the outbuilding will dictate the power required. If all that is needed is a socket or two and some lighting, then the power requirements are fairly modest, a 13A supply would probably be more than adequate.

Why does a DC/DC power supply have a different voltage?

The DC/DC power supply, also called DC/DC converter, is designed to input a DC voltage and output a different DC voltage. This is achieved by using a switching method instead of the linear method.
